Outdoor Activity for 5 Year Olds





Engaging with your children outdoors is a great way of engaging them. It is great for mental and physical health as well as stress reduction. You can improve your sleep and boost your immune system by spending time outside.

Outdoor time can be a great way to help kids build confidence. This confidence can also be used in other areas. Getting outdoors can also teach children resilience and grit, important capacities for long-term wellness. Outdoor time can provide benefits such as vitamin D and fresh air that boost your immune systems. In addition, getting outdoors is an opportunity to build social-emotional skills and learn about nature.

Outdoor time can help kids improve their cognitive skills. For example, children can draw or write observations of things they find outside. They can also compare objects with items found in other outdoor spaces. They can take photographs of the items and classify them. This will enable them to understand more about nature, as well as improve their reading skills.




One fun way to engage with your kids is through games. These games can either be enjoyed by the entire family or can be played solo. These games can include traditional hopscotch grids, reverse hide-and go seek, and pass the ball. You can add games to your child's repertoire as they get older and more confident.

Bubbles are fun and easy for children younger than 5. You can also make your own bubbles using a bubble machine or wand. You can also make your own mud pies using rocks and leaves. This is a great activity after a rainy day.

Another great activity is a nature hike. You can also use a nature book for this activity. This will enable children to learn about different animals and plants. You can also use a library book or online research to help you identify the plants and animals.

Another fun activity is a treasure hunt. A scavenger hunt checklist can be used, or your children can search for objects they find outdoors. Leaves, stones, sticks, and other items are all good options. These materials can be used for crafts or in other activities.

Are there any tips I can offer parents who want to get their kids exercising?

Parents who want their kids to begin exercising should encourage them to try different activities. The more kids participate in physical activity, the more likely they will continue doing so later in life.

Parents shouldn't push their children to take part in certain activities. Instead, parents should encourage their children to explore other options such as running, swimming, dancing, martial art, basketball, tennis, volleyball and softball.
